PROVIDENCE, R.I./JUPITER, FLA. – Abbott Walter Dressler of Providence and Jupiter, Fla., died Nov. 16. He was the beloved husband of Phyllis (Bernstein) Dressler for 56 years. Born in Providence, a son of the late Joseph and Sarah (Weisman) Dressler, he was a resident of both Providence and Jupiter. He was an owner and president of the former Colfax Inc. for many years until his retirement in 1999.

He was a graduate of Providence Country Day School and the University of Miami, where he was a member of Tau Epsilon Phi Fraternity. He was a past president of AFOA, past master of Redwood Lodge of the Masons, past chairman of Israel Bonds, an alumnus of Leadership RI, a member of Temple Beth-El and its brotherhood and a member of Admirals Cove and Ledgemont Country Clubs. He was also past president of Admirals Cove Property Owners Association.

He was the devoted father of Sherri Dressler Klein and her husband Gary; Gary Dressler and his wife Susan; and Larry Dressler and his wife Amy, all of Cranston. Dear brother of the late Maurice and Sidney Dressler and Joan Abrams. Loving grandfather of Joshua, Jared, Scott and Ross.
